Lead Test Engineer – Tactical Communications

Scottsdale, AZ
Up to $65/hour

Position Overview

Seeking a Lead Test Engineer to support tactical communications and embedded systems programs. This role leads integration, verification, and validation (IV&V) efforts for mission-critical systems within the Unified Testing Framework (UTF) environment.

You will oversee test engineering teams and ensure embedded hardware/software systems meet performance, reliability, and security requirements for advanced defense technologies.


Key Responsibilities

  • Lead a team of integration and test engineers, providing mentorship and technical direction

  • Develop and maintain test strategies for embedded systems

  • Architect test automation frameworks and validation solutions

  • Design and execute system-level test plans and procedures

  • Develop automated test scripts using Python (3.9+)

  • Coordinate hardware, firmware, and software integration testing

  • Lead Test Readiness Reviews (TRRs) and testing assessments

  • Implement verification & validation (V&V) methodologies

  • Support Agile development and CI/CD testing pipelines

  • Maintain test documentation, procedures, and reporting


Required Education &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or related STEM field

  • 8+ years of relevant experience, OR

  • Master’s degree with 6+ years of experience

  • Experience leading engineering or test teams (3–5 members)


Key Technical Skills

  • Python programming (object-oriented) and scripting

  • Test automation frameworks

  • Hardware/software integration testing

  • Experience with signal analyzers, signal generators, or USRP test equipment

  • Knowledge of CI/CD and automated testing pipelines

  • Experience with embedded systems development and testing


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with tactical communications or RF systems

  • Experience in defense or aerospace programs

  • Familiarity with requirements management and traceability tools
